怎么让电脑作为服务器
卡尔云官网
www.kaeryun.com
好,我现在需要帮用户解答“怎么让电脑作为服务器”的问题,用户希望我以知乎风格,结合专业知识,用大白话写一篇至少1000字的文章,还要有SEO优化,突出关键词。
我得明确用户的需求,他们可能想让自己的电脑变成服务器,用于 hosting 网站或者提供服务,但可能对服务器配置不太了解,所以需要详细但易懂地解释。
我得考虑文章的结构,这样的指南会分为几个部分:硬件配置、软件安装、注意事项和常见问题,这样逻辑清晰,读者容易跟随。
硬件配置部分,我需要推荐合适的硬件,至少2GB的内存,至少10GB的硬盘空间,一个好的CPU和主板,以及足够的GPU,还要提到电源和机箱,这些都是基础配置。
软件安装部分,Windows环境下,安装CentOS或Ubuntu是最常见的,我得解释如何下载、安装、配置这些软件,比如安装Nginx和Apache,配置防火墙,设置SSH服务,以及如何管理用户和组。
注意事项部分,要提醒用户注意系统稳定性,避免恶意软件,定期备份数据,以及考虑备份数据到外部存储,这些都是确保服务器安全和数据安全的重要点。
常见问题部分,可以列出一些常见的问题,比如安装Nginx时的配置问题,防火墙设置的冲突,以及如何处理系统更新的问题,这样读者可以预见并解决一些常见的问题。
我得总结一下,强调虽然配置了一台服务器看起来简单,但实际操作中需要仔细配置和维护,才能稳定运行。
在写作风格上,要保持大白话,避免专业术语过多,让读者容易理解,要确保关键词如“怎么让电脑作为服务器”、“服务器配置”等多次出现,符合SEO优化。
我需要把这些思路整理成一篇连贯的文章,确保每个部分都详细但不冗长,同时涵盖必要的信息,这样用户不仅能了解如何配置,还能在实际操作中遇到问题时找到解决办法。
越来越多的人想让自己的电脑变成服务器,用来 hosting 网站、提供文件存储或运行应用,虽然电脑可以作为服务器,但并不是所有电脑都适合做服务器,要让电脑成为真正的服务器,需要一定的硬件配置和软件准备,下面,我来详细告诉你怎么让电脑变成服务器。
硬件配置
硬件是服务器的基础,配置不当会导致服务器性能低下,甚至无法正常运行,以下是一些基本的硬件配置建议:
-
内存(RAM)
至少需要2GB的内存,建议4GB以上,内存越大,处理任务越流畅。 -
存储空间
硬盘至少需要10GB的可用空间,建议20GB以上,如果需要存储大量文件或运行大型软件,建议选择SSD(固态硬盘),速度快,读写能力强。 -
CPU(处理器)
至少需要一款主流的Intel或AMD处理器,比如Intel Core i5或AMD Ryzen 5,不要选择性能太差的处理器,否则处理任务会很慢。 -
主板
主板需要支持你的CPU,有足够的扩展插槽(如USB3.0、PCIe、HDMI等),以方便连接外设和扩展卡。 -
电源
电源需要稳定,至少65W以上,以支持你的硬件需求。 -
机箱
机箱要足够大,能装下你的硬件,同时要有良好的散热设计,避免过热影响硬件。
软件安装
安装服务器软件后,你的电脑就具备了服务器功能,以下是几种常见的服务器操作系统和软件:
-
操作系统
- Windows服务器:如果你的电脑已经安装了Windows 10或更高版本,可以通过“计算机” > “管理” > “服务器和网络设置”来安装Windows Server。
- Linux服务器:Linux是最流行的服务器操作系统之一,你可以从官方下载Ubuntu或CentOS,安装完成后进行配置。
-
Web服务器软件
- Nginx:这是一个非常流行的Web服务器,安装后可以让你的电脑轻松成为网站 hosting 服务器。
- Apache:这也是一个经典的Web服务器,安装后可以运行自己的网站。
-
文件存储软件
- ZFS(RAID备份系统):如果你需要存储大量数据,可以安装ZFS,它能提供类似RAID的功能,同时支持文件加密和备份。
-
数据库软件
- MySQL:如果你需要运行一个数据库服务器,可以安装MySQL,它是一个非常稳定的开源数据库。
-
虚拟化软件
- VMware或VirtualBox:如果你不想让多任务干扰服务器性能,可以使用虚拟化软件,将操作系统虚拟化运行。
注意事项
-
系统稳定性
服务器需要运行大量的任务,所以系统必须非常稳定,安装完成后,定期进行系统更新和补丁安装,以修复漏洞。 -
避免恶意软件
电脑作为服务器,需要高度防护,安装完成后,安装杀毒软件,并定期扫描系统。 -
数据备份
服务器上的数据非常重要,定期备份到本地或远程存储是必须的。 -
外部存储
如果你不想备份数据到电脑上,可以考虑购买一个外部硬盘或SSD,作为数据备份的存储设备。
常见问题
-
安装Nginx时配置问题
- Nginx需要配置服务器上的域名和端口,确保它可以正确地绑定到你的网站域名。
- 如果Nginx无法启动,可以检查日志文件,看看是否有错误信息。
-
防火墙设置问题
- 火wall需要设置为“主动”模式,以允许Nginx的连接。
- 如果防火墙阻止了Nginx的连接,可以尝试暂时关闭防火墙,然后重启Nginx。
-
系统更新问题
定期进行系统更新,以修复已知的漏洞,避免被黑客攻击。
让电脑变成服务器需要硬件和软件的双重准备,选择合适的硬件配置,安装合适的服务器操作系统和软件,按照正确的步骤进行配置和维护,就能让你的电脑成为真正的服务器,虽然过程有点复杂,但一旦配置成功,你的电脑就能为你的网站或业务提供强大的支持。
卡尔云官网
www.kaeryun.com